Faraday to Blackwood and sons1   25 January 18582

Royal Institution | 25 January 1857 [sic]

Gentlemen

I have received from some friend to whom I desire to return my best thanks a copy of the Scenes of Clerical life3. Can you aid me in directing them to the right quarter & if so will you do me that favour4[.]

I am Gentlemen | Your faithful Servant | M. Faraday

Messrs Blackwood & Sons

Blackwood & Son Scottish publishing firm. See Tredrey (1954).
Dated on the basis of the publication of the book.
Eliot (1858), published by Blackwood. See Eliot, Diary, 8 January 1858, p.292 for her instruction that Faraday be sent a copy.
